Output 16c4c686ad27eb52885e88f5ee9f4ae0f49035a6e2b65dc4110e5c7671b4f2e9:4

value
65970534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38378a33d28315e38adb45234c495fe0195e271a OP_EQUAL
address
MD2Qc9cf8hwH5KZmGo67GWHKkHkWqPviyU
transaction
16c4c686ad27eb52885e88f5ee9f4ae0f49035a6e2b65dc4110e5c7671b4f2e9
spent
true